## Runbook: Carving the user module out of Bramblecore

During the split window, the extracted user service (`userling`) runs alongside the Bramblecore monolith with dual writes enabled. If replication lag exceeds 30 seconds, flip `USERLING_DUAL_WRITE=off` and page the data platform rotation. Do not restart the monolith mid-sync; in-flight sessions will be dropped. The userling service authenticates back to the monolith's internal API using a service credential stored in its env file. Add the line below to `/etc/userling/.env`.

env line for fafof-fahag: LEDGER_TOKEN5=f8790

Subject: Invoicely renderer cut-over complete

Hello plugin authors,

The cut-over of the Invoicely PDF renderer to the new layout engine finished last night. Legacy template hooks still work but are deprecated; the new pagination API is now the default. Output parity checks passed on our sample set. For reference when updating your plugins, the renderer now starts with these configuration values.

settings of fafog-haduf:
ZORIX_PIN=4648
ZORIX_METRICS_HOST=metrics.zorix.paliqsys.corp
ZORIX_LOG_LEVEL=info
ZORIX_TENANT=druix

## Account Recovery — Trace Reconstruction

When a user at Briarhollow reports a failed account recovery, pull the trace ID from the Gatewright edge logs and follow it through AuthCore, MailRelay, and the Ledgerette audit service. Confirm each hop emits a span; gaps usually mean the recovery token expired mid-flow. If you need to decrypt the archived trace bundle for review, the archive accepts the recovery passphrase below.

unlock words, tawif-tahop: oliys-ulawyn-tamdor-lamys-casox-jormir-fraius-kasath-ulador-ulamir-holir-sorys-holeth

**Ticket PLX-4417: WebSocket reconnect storms after idle timeout**

Plugin authors integrating with the Murmuration relay may see their clients reconnect in a tight loop when the server closes an idle socket. Our backoff header is being ignored by the v3 client shim, so plugins hammer the gateway. A patched shim is available; please verify your plugin against the build identified below.

pipeline stamp: htk9_ce63042d9